O. BTdK 642
Other nos.: O. KV 18/2.329
  
Description: Limestone (jar lid), diam. 10.6, thickness 2.1 cm. Inscribed on two sides: on obverse (underside of jar lid) 5 lines and on reverse (upper side of jar lid) 8 lines in black ink. Top obverse = top reverse. Damaged: writing on reverse partly effaced. On upper side of jar lid a workmen's mark (or 'funny sign') incised.
Classification: account : deficit - delivery
Keywords: lamp - rags
Provenance: Valley of Kings, workmen's huts near KV 18. Findspot: B.SH1-N.A10. (see Remarks)
Publication: Dorn, Arbeiterhütten , 403-404 (description, transliteration, translation and commentary), pls. 517-519 (photographs, facsimiles and transcriptions).
Dates mentioned: II pr.t sw 11 (obv. 4); II pr.t sw 13 (obv. 5); II pr.t sw [...] (rev. ~5#); [...] sw 22 (rev. ~6#); [...] sw 23 (rev. 7)
Dates attributed: Mid dyn. 20 (Dorn)
Contents: Deficit of old rags for lamps with dated notes when an anonymous delivered partial amounts. Incised xpS -sign on reverse.
Terminology: aHa n isy nty r xbs (obv. 1-2); wHm (over obv. 4; rev. 1; 3); wDA.t (obv. 3); dmD (rev. 6, 7)
Names/Titles: -
Remarks: Provenance: for the findspot identification see Dorn, Arbeiterhütten , 17-19.
